As many others I chose this cruise to up my status. Many blue cards onboard, just to taste cruising? No one mentioned the murder, I searched up the cabin number out of curiosity, it was on a different deck and side of the ship from my cabin. Lines were everything on this cruise. People trying to maximize their less than 24 hour experience. Food quality was par for Princess. Lines, lines, lines. Great scenery smooth and slow cruise. Staff seemed very busy. People all over the decks, watching the big screens, lounges with entertainment, all like a real multi day/ nigt cruise. Decor of the ship was very similar to that of the Grand, branding, make them look alike. Staff were delt a tough assignment, one day and everyone wants everything.other than the lines the only negative Imhave was the corn, overcooked. Princess needs to be more clear on what the softdrink package includes. Deceptive marketing but what do you want for $8.05?

Cabin Review

Balcony

Cabin BC

Nice balcony cabin, rusty pipes outside, something had been repaired that the steward needed to check on. Cooling system worked. Shower adequate. Room size is nice. For one day cruise great. Loved the scenery.
